Gentoo Websites Logo
Go to: Gentoo Home Documentation Forums Lists Bugs Planet Store Wiki Get Gentoo!
Bug 510940 - >=media-libs/libepoxy-1.2 keywording request
Summary: >=media-libs/libepoxy-1.2 keywording request
Status: RESOLVED FIXED
Alias: None
Product: Gentoo Linux
Classification: Unclassified
Component: [OLD] Keywording and Stabilization (show other bugs)
Hardware: All Linux
: Normal enhancement (vote)
Assignee: Gentoo X packagers
URL:
Whiteboard:
Keywords: KEYWORDREQ
Depends on:
Blocks: 518256
  Show dependency tree
 
Reported: 2014-05-21 13:52 UTC by Chí-Thanh Christopher Nguyễn
Modified: 2017-02-26 05:46 UTC (History)
6 users (show)

See Also:
Package list:
Runtime testing required: ---


Attachments

Note You need to log in before you can comment on or make changes to this bug.
Description Chí-Thanh Christopher Nguyễn gentoo-dev 2014-05-21 13:52:37 UTC
Arches, please keyword media-libs/libepoxy. It is required for Xwayland in the upcoming x11-base/xorg-server-1.6 release.

If you do not wish to keyword this package, please mask the wayland flag for x11-base/xorg-server in your profile.

Target keywords: ~alpha ~amd64 ~arm ~hppa ~ia64 ~m68k ~mips ~ppc ~ppc64 ~s390 ~sh ~sparc ~x86
Comment 1 Jeroen Roovers (RETIRED) gentoo-dev 2014-05-21 14:04:47 UTC
(In reply to Chí-Thanh Christopher Nguyễn from comment #0)
> the upcoming x11-base/xorg-server-1.6 release.

1.16? Also, where is it?
Comment 2 Chí-Thanh Christopher Nguyễn gentoo-dev 2014-05-21 14:06:31 UTC
Sorry, xorg-server-1.16.
I plan to add the release candidate 1.15.99.902 to the tree under p.mask soon.
Comment 3 Chí-Thanh Christopher Nguyễn gentoo-dev 2014-05-26 12:08:47 UTC
keyworded ~arm
Comment 4 Jeroen Roovers (RETIRED) gentoo-dev 2014-06-06 13:28:44 UTC
Marked ~hppa.
Comment 5 Tobias Klausmann (RETIRED) gentoo-dev 2014-07-20 14:20:22 UTC
I think this should depend on mesa"

libtool: compile:  alpha-unknown-linux-gnu-gcc -std=gnu99 -DHAVE_CONFIG_H -I. -I/var/tmp/portage/media-libs/libepoxy-1.2/work/libepoxy-1.2/src -I.. -I/var/tmp/portage/media-libs/libepoxy-1.2/work/libepoxy-1.2/include -I../include -Wall -Wpointer-arith -Wmissing-declarations -Wformat=2 -Wstrict-prototypes -Wmissing-prototypes -Wnested-externs -Wbad-function-cast -Wold-style-definition -Wdeclaration-after-statement -Wunused -Wuninitialized -Wshadow -Wmissing-noreturn -Wmissing-format-attribute -Wredundant-decls -Werror=implicit -Werror=nonnull -Werror=init-self -Werror=main -Werror=missing-braces -Werror=sequence-point -Werror=return-type -Werror=trigraphs -Werror=array-bounds -Werror=write-strings -Werror=address -Werror=int-to-pointer-cast -Werror=pointer-to-int-cast -fno-strict-aliasing -Wno-int-conversion -fvisibility=hidden -mieee -pipe -O2 -mcpu=ev67 -c /var/tmp/portage/media-libs/libepoxy-1.2/work/libepoxy-1.2/src/dispatch_common.c  -fPIC -DPIC -o .libs/dispatch_common.o
In file included from /var/tmp/portage/media-libs/libepoxy-1.2/work/libepoxy-1.2/include/epoxy/egl.h:46:0,
                 from /var/tmp/portage/media-libs/libepoxy-1.2/work/libepoxy-1.2/src/dispatch_common.h:48,
                 from /var/tmp/portage/media-libs/libepoxy-1.2/work/libepoxy-1.2/src/dispatch_common.c:103:
../include/epoxy/egl_generated.h:10:29: fatal error: EGL/eglplatform.h: No such file or directory
compilation terminated.
make[3]: *** [dispatch_common.lo] Error 1


After installing media-libs/mesa-10.0.4 it compiles & tests just fine.
Comment 6 Chí-Thanh Christopher Nguyễn gentoo-dev 2014-07-21 09:06:04 UTC
Dependency on mesa[egl] was added to libepoxy ebuilds.
Comment 7 Tobias Klausmann (RETIRED) gentoo-dev 2014-07-24 10:24:17 UTC
Keyworded on alpha.
Comment 8 Agostino Sarubbo gentoo-dev 2015-02-19 09:01:59 UTC
+  19 Feb 2015; Agostino Sarubbo <ago@gentoo.org> libepoxy-1.2.ebuild:
+  Add ~ia64/~ppc/~ppc64/~sparc wrt bug #510940
+
Comment 9 Joshua Kinard gentoo-dev 2015-09-08 09:05:09 UTC
~mips was added at some point, updating bug...
Comment 10 Matt Turner gentoo-dev 2017-02-26 05:46:03 UTC
commit cb9ca092c519c749551e59b5d205a9f75e39c51d
Author: Matt Turner <mattst88@gentoo.org>
Date:   Sat Feb 25 21:40:44 2017 -0800

    profiles: Mask glamor and wayland USE flags on m68k and s390.


(whoops, I realize that the commit message incorrectly says s390 instead of sh)

s390 was handled years ago.